    Absolutely loved seeing kabuki for the first time!

    Absolutely loved seeing kabuki for the first time! Some tips: if you’re not someone who already enjoys theater, you might not enjoy sitting through the whole 3.5-4 hour show. Instead, it might be better to get the less expensive single act standing tickets the day of, if you just want to experience kabuki a little. 100% get the English audio guides if your Japanese isn’t great (and even if it is, it would probably help for understanding the context of what is going on). I chose to sit in the balcony A seats, but wish I’d splurged on second class, or even first class seats. Sometimes it was a little hard to see the whole stage from the balcony, and the seats below offer a much better view/more immersive experience. Make sure to purchase a bento to eat during intermission before entering (you can buy them in the basement). There are not a lot of food options in the theater, but plenty of drink options (and taiyaki if you’re looking for a quick snack). The intermissions are long (30 and 20 minutes respectively), but break up the show well.
